EPHRATA 3, QUINCY 0

EPHRATA - The host Lady Tigers of Ephrata (5-4, 1-0) cruised to a 3-0 (25-13, 25-13, 25-16) win to open Central Washington Athletic Conference (CWAC) play last night.

Kendra De Hoog led Ephrata with 15 kills and five blocks, Heidi Buchert had 12 kills and three aces and Hallie Duff has 18 assists.

"We had some great play from a lot of contributors and our bench as well," Ephrata head coach Emily Petersen said.

Cassidee Davis had two kills and two blocks for Quincy (2-4, 0-1), while Madison Petersen added eight digs and Janna Hodges finished with seven assists.

"We just struggled tonight all the way around," Quincy head coach Pam Young said. "We got behind and started playing to not make mistakes instead of to win the point."
